Seven Dead in Blaze In Eight-Storey Building

PARIS: Dozens injured as about 200 firefighters tackle fire in 16th arrondissement in French capital.

Seven people died and another was seriously injured in a building fire in a wealthy Paris neighbourhood on Monday night, the fire service said.

“The toll could still increase because the fire is still in progress on the 7th and 8th floors” of the eight-storey block, a fire service spokesman said at the scene.

The blaze in the French capital’s trendy 16th arrondissement also left 27 people — including three firefighters — with minor injuries.

Some of those affected scrambled on to nearby roofs to escape the smoke and flames, and needed to be rescued by fire crews.

Fire service spokesman Clement Cognon told: “We had to carry out many rescues, including some people who had taken refuge on the roofs.”

Around 200 firefighters were still at the scene in the early hours of Tuesday, battling the blaze and treating the injured.
